Divorce Proceedings in California: Your Rights Explained detailed

Navigating a divorce can be challenging, especially when it involves complex legal processes. In California, the process of dissolving a marriage is governed by specific laws and regulations designed to ensure the rights of both parties involved. Understanding these fundamental rights is crucial for achieving a fair and equitable outcome.

One key right during divorce proceedings in California is the right to request proper representation. It is strongly recommended to consult with an experienced family law attorney who can guide you through the intricacies of the legal system and defend your interests.

  • Another important right involves property revealing. Both spouses are required to completely disclose their financial standing, including income, assets, debts, and expenses.
  • California is a shared ownership state, meaning that any assets acquired during the marriage are generally considered to be owned equally by both spouses. Splitting of community property is often a central point in divorce proceedings.
  • In some cases, one spouse may request spousal support. This type of financial assistance is intended to help the financially dependent spouse adjust to life after the divorce.

It's important to remember that these are just a few of the key rights involved in California divorce proceedings. The specific circumstances of each case can vary widely, so it is always best to seek guidance from an experienced family law attorney for personalized legal advice and support.

Southern California Spousal Support: What You Need to Know

Navigating divorce can be a complex journey, especially when it comes to spousal support. In California, transfers of money from one spouse to another after divorce are governed by specific regulations.

  • Considerations such as the length of the marriage, each spouse's earning capacity, and standard of living are thoroughly evaluated when determining the amount and duration of spousal support.
  • Interim support may be granted during the divorce, while ongoing support is determined in some instances.
  • Changing spousal support arrangements can be achievable under certain conditions, such as a substantial change in the economic status of either spouse.

Consulting an experienced family law attorney is highly recommended to understand your rights and alternatives regarding spousal support in California.
